Dear friend, do not imitate what is evil but what is good. Anyone who does what is good is from God. Anyone who does what is evil has not seen God.
3 John 1:11//

It is no coincidence that the previous verses to this passage give us an example of an evil man and the verses after this give us an example of a good man. This verse is not passive aggressive. It is simply stating a clear fact.
